Work Done = Force * displacement
U know the displacement is 100 m, so u need the value of force applied on the body in 'Newtons' to calculate work done

The force needed to accelerate an object at some rate is proportional to the object's mass.The object may be moved by as small a force as you want. It just won't accelerate at a very high rate.
If an object does not move, no work is performed. Work is performed by a force acting through a distance.
